deposition
—deposition /ˌdep.əˈzɪʃ.ən/
Ⅰ noun [C] LEGAL (STATEMENT) ► F0 a formal written statement made or used in a law court: » Before the court case, we had to file/give a deposition.» Our lawyer took a deposition from us.» a sworn depositionThesaurus+: ↑Official documents
Ⅱ noun [U] FORMAL (REMOVAL) ► F0 the act of removing someone important from a powerful position: » Crowds celebrated the dictator's deposition.Thesaurus+: ↑Firing staff and being fired |
